成熟期橄榄型油菜角果抗裂角性试验与分析  被引量:3

Test and Analysis on the Silique Shatter Resistance of Mature Oilseed Rape(Brassica napus L.)

摘  要:为了获知甘蓝型油菜角果的抗裂角性,采用自行研制的油菜角果抗裂角性碰撞检测装置对秦油7号成熟期油菜角果层的上、中、下3个部位的角果抗裂角性进行了试验研究,并分析了油菜角果大小差异对抗裂角性的影响。试验结果表明,成熟期甘蓝型油菜角果的抗裂角系数随着含水率的下降而减小;当含水率大于20%时,抗裂角系数与其含水率具有线性关系,含水率小于20%时,抗裂角系数显著下降并最终趋于0.16左右;秦油7号油菜角果的抗裂角系数在0.151~0.577之间;油菜角果的大小影响其抗裂角性,同一株油菜上角果尺寸大的抗裂角系数比角果尺寸小的大。In this paper , we make some experiments on the silique shatter resistance from three parts of the oilseed rape ( Brassica napus L .):top, middle and bottom .These experiments are conducted on the testing device of silique shatter resistance invented by Jiangsu University using the method of improved random impact test .In addition , we also analyse the influence of the oilseed pod ’ s size on the silique shatter resistance .The results show that the silique shattering resist-ance index of mature oilseed rape ( Brassica napus L .) decreases with its moisture content decreasing .When the mois-ture content is larger than 20%, it is nearly linear relationship between the silique shattering resistance index and the moisture content .When the moisture content is less than 20%,the silique shattering resistance index decreases dramatic-ally, finally tending to be around 0.16.The silique shattering resistance index of oilseed rape (Qin You 7) ranges be-tween 0 .11 and 0 .577 .Besides ,the size of the oilseed rape has important effect on the silique shatter resistance .The bigger of the size , the greater of the silique shattering resistance index .
